What is 5G Technology?

5G technology refers too the⁤ fifth generation of wireless​ network technology, succeeding 4G LTE. ‍It is designed to provide:

  • Lightning-fast data transfer speeds (up to 100 times faster than 4G)
  • Ultra-low latency (response time as low as 1ms)
  • Ability ‌to connect a larger number of devices concurrently

⁢ These features make 5G an ideal‌ catalyst for⁤ the next wave of digital change in education,enabling seamless ‍delivery ⁤and interaction with multimedia-rich content.

Key Benefits of 5G for Online​ Learning

1. Enhanced Video Streaming and Real-Time Collaboration

⁤ ⁢ With⁤ 5G’s extraordinary bandwidth, students and‍ educators can engage in high-definition‍ video lectures, live‌ webinars, and⁤ interactive sessions without⁢ buffering or ‌connection drops. This ⁣is notably valuable for fields like ‍medicine and engineering, where detailed visuals and demonstrations are crucial.

2.Immersive Learning Through Augmented and Virtual Reality

‍ 5G’s low latency supports the integration of AR and VR educational experiences.⁣ Think virtual labs, 3D explorations, or interactive field trips—all accessible from any location.These immersive‌ technologies make complex concepts easier to grasp and ‍can⁣ considerably boost engagement.

3. Bridging the Digital Divide

Equitable access has ⁤always been a challenge in online learning. With widespread 5G coverage, ​high-speed ⁣internet becomes⁤ more available even in rural and underserved areas. This helps bridge the digital divide, giving more learners the⁤ prospect to participate ‍in quality online⁢ education.

4. Increased Mobility and Flexibility

⁤ 5G’s robust connectivity empowers learning on the go. Whether it’s ⁢streaming a course during a commute or accessing class‌ materials outside‌ the home, students benefit from the⁣ flexibility and convenience ⁤of truly mobile learning.

5. enhanced IoT Integration

‍ ​ ⁤ The Internet of Things (IoT) in education relies on interconnected devices and sensors, such as smart whiteboards, connected ‍lab equipment, and wearable devices. 5G supports vast numbers of devices, allowing educators ‍to integrate technology-rich environments that extend beyond customary classroom walls.

Real-World​ Case Studies: 5G in Action for Online Learning

‌ Early adopters worldwide are already testing the transformative potential of 5G in education:

  • South Korea’s 5G-Powered Classrooms: schools in South ‍Korea, one of the global ⁢leaders in 5G rollout, have implemented VR-based science classes over 5G networks.Students interact with 3D models in real-time,making learning more engaging and effective.
  • Nokia‍ and the University of Technology Sydney: In Australia, 5G-powered remote teaching with high-definition⁣ video and real-time feedback has allowed students in distant areas to ​fully participate in ⁣innovation workshops and collaborative projects.
  • UK’s 5G RuralDorset Project: 5G has ‍enabled interactive and live streamed lessons in rural Dorset, greatly improving access and participation for ⁤children who previously had limited online learning opportunities.

​ ‍ These examples illustrate how‍ 5G technology is already redefining remote education, ​making it more inclusive and interactive.
